#3c1204 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3c1204 is composed of 23.5% red, 7.1%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70% magenta, 93.3%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 15 degrees, a saturation of 87.5% and a lightness of 12.5%. #3c1204 color hex could be obtained by blending #782408 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#3c1204

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050100 is the darkest color, while #fef5f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c1204

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#21201f is the less saturated color, while #3e1102 is the most saturated one.
